Biography

As a sophomore: Finished the season 1-0 in singles, winning his only contested match in the Bulldogs' season finale at Brandeis to help the Bulldogs to a 10-5 team victory ... Was a consistent factor in the doubles lineup, going 6-4 in 10 matches with five different playing partners.

As a freshman: Went 4-5 in first season at Bryant including 4-4 in dual matches ... Earned first collegiate win over Holy Cross' Scot Brownell, 6-2, 6-0 ... Also picked up wins over Minnesota State's Mike Lindamen, Monmouth's Stephen Suboleski, and Hofstra's Jason Sinkoff at No. 6 singles. 

Before Bryant: The second Canadian on the Bulldogs’ roster, joining fellow countryman Nicholai Hill ...  Crowley is a Top-45 under-18 player and two-time conference doubles champion.  Ranked nationally in the Canadian Top-60 in Canada, he recently won the Cricket Club U-18 OTA tournament ...  During this past high school season, he was the WOSSA Champion, OFSSA bronze medalist and named as the school’s athlete of the year.

Personal: Son of Susan and Michael Crowley, Connor Crowley was born on January 23, 1992 ... Has one brother, Michael, and two sisters, Angela and Madeleine.
